Ambipar

Ambipar, officially known as Ambipar Group, is a leading Brazilian company headquartered in São Paulo, Brazil. Established in 1995, Ambipar has carved a niche in the environmental services industry, specialising in emergency response, waste management, and environmental consulting. With a strong operational presence across Brazil and expanding into international markets, the company has achieved significant milestones, including strategic partnerships and innovative service offerings. Ambipar's core services include hazardous waste management, environmental remediation, and spill response, distinguished by their commitment to sustainability and safety. The company is recognised for its advanced technology and expertise, positioning itself as a trusted partner in environmental protection. With a robust market presence, Ambipar continues to set industry standards, reflecting its dedication to excellence and environmental stewardship.

Ambipar's reported carbon emissions

In 2023, Ambipar reported total carbon emissions of approximately 225,242,570 kg CO2e from Scope 1, 669,850 kg CO2e from Scope 2, and 50,133,240 kg CO2e from Scope 3. This represents a significant commitment to reducing their carbon footprint, with a target to achieve a 50% reduction in both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ions by 2025, using 2020 as the baseline year. Ambipar also aims for carbon neutrality across its operations by 2030. In the long term, the company has set ambitious goals to reduce absolute Scope 1 and 2 emissions by 90% and Scope 3 emissions by 90% by 2050, based on a 2022 baseline. These targets align with the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) and reflect a commitment to sustainable practices within the professional services sector.
